Post subject: 2.4ghz recievers
Reply with quote
 
my question is that of if the controllers are using 2.4 ghz on all of them how is it that a reciever is not compatable with another controller? i know dumb question. i have some nyko controllers that i really want to use but have no recievers and they are no longer available online. it takes one reciever with 2 dongle plugs.they are 5 yrs old. im new to xboxs as everyone else has already done stuff im just trying. 2 more chapters on half life 2. is there really a half life one game?

Wireless controllers transmit on different frequencies...channels if you will. Just like cordless phones.
Figuring out what frequency is a little involved, but can be done. You would have to open your controller and take a look at the transmitting crystal. Once you know what type of crystal is in the controller you can match it in the receiver.

the crystal is on the little board on the front of the controller? how do i match it? is there a tut somewhere? or should i just google it? really want to use these controllers i have. do i just have to take chance on a reciever to see if it will match up or not? i think you know what im trying to ask. Sounds like you are up for the challenge Very Happy

When you open the controller, you should see a component with a metal cap. It should be about 1/4 inch long. There are numbers on the cap to indicate what type of crystal it is. Any electronics shop should carry them. Find the match and replace the one that is in the receiver.

Of course soldering will be required. Hopefully you're good at it. I'm sure someone at the electronics store can give you some pointers.
